1 2 3

缠论精准笔源码

[复制链接]
查看35511 | 回复39 | 2023-4-20 15:27:03 | 显示全部楼层 |阅读模式
指标公式编辑
QQ截图20230420152631.jpg

[hide]
  1. SHORT:=7;LONG:=19;
  2. MA1:=MA(CLOSE,5);
  3. MA2:=MA(CLOSE,10);
  4. MA3:=MA(CLOSE,20);
  5. MA4:=MA(CLOSE,60);
  6. T:=PERIOD;
  7. D:=IF(T=0,30,{1F}
  8. IF(T=1,25,{5F}        
  9. IF(T=8,25,{多分钟}
  10. IF(T=2,20,{15F}
  11. IF(T=3,20,{30F}
  12. IF(T=4,20,{60F}
  13. IF(T=5,10,{日}
  14. IF(T=6,10,{周}
  15. IF(T=7,10,{月}
  16. IF(T=9,10,{多日}
  17. IF(T=10,10{季},10{年})))))))))));
  18. RMA:=EMA(CLOSE,SHORT),COLORLIGRAY;
  19. NMA:=EMA(CLOSE,LONG),COLORMAGENTA;
  20. RISK:=IF(NMA>RMA,NMA,DRAWNULL),COLORGREEN;
  21. DRAWLINE(L=LLV(L,BARSLAST(CROSS(NMA,RMA))+1) AND L=LLV(L,D) AND RMA<=NMA,L,H=HHV(H,BARSLAST(CROSS(RMA,NMA))+1) AND H=HHV(H,D) AND RMA>=NMA,H,0),COLOR0000FF,LINETHICK2;
  22. DRAWLINE(H=HHV(H,BARSLAST(CROSS(RMA,NMA))+1) AND H=HHV(H,D) AND RMA>=NMA,H,L=LLV(L,BARSLAST(CROSS(NMA,RMA))+1) AND L=LLV(L,D) AND RMA<=NMA,L,0),COLOR238E23,LINETHICK2;
  23. 重心线:=(H+L+O+C*3)/6;
  24. {DRAWGBKLAST(V>1,STRIP(RGB(60,10,0),RGB(10,50,0),0));}
  25. NX:=(3*CLOSE+LOW+OPEN+HIGH)/6;   
  26. 牛线:=(20*NX+19*REF(NX,1)+18*REF(NX,2)+17*REF(NX,3)+16*REF(NX,4)   
  27. +15*REF(NX,5)+14*REF(NX,6)+13*REF(NX,7)+12*REF(NX,8)+11*REF(NX,9)   
  28. +10*REF(NX,10)+9*REF(NX,11)+8*REF(NX,12)+7*REF(NX,13)+6*REF(NX,14)   
  29. +5*REF(NX,15)+4*REF(NX,16)+3*REF(NX,17)   
  30. +2*REF(NX,18)+REF(NX,20))/210;
  31. {牛熊线:MA(牛线,6),COLORGREEN,LINETHICK2;}
  32. 牛熊线:=MA(牛线,6);{,COLORLIGREEN,LINETHICK1;}
  33. {DRAWBAND(重心线,RGB(168,18,38),牛熊线,RGB(10,100,200));}
  34. 简底:=H>REF(H,1) AND REF(H,1)<REF(H,2) AND L>REF(L,1) AND REF(L,1)<REF(L,2);
  35. 简顶:=H<REF(H,1) AND REF(H,1)>REF(H,2) AND L<REF(L,1) AND REF(L,1)>REF(L,2);
  36. 包含1:=REF(H,1)>=REF(H,2) AND REF(L,1)<=REF(L,2);
  37. 包含2:=REF(H,1)<=REF(H,2) AND REF(L,1)>=REF(L,2);
  38. 包底1:=H>REF(H,2) AND REF(H,2)<REF(H,3) AND L>REF(L,1) AND REF(L,1)<REF(L,3);
  39. 包底2:=H>REF(H,1) AND REF(H,1)<REF(H,3) AND L>REF(L,2) AND REF(L,2)<REF(L,3);
  40. 包顶1:=H<REF(H,1) AND REF(H,1)>REF(H,3) AND L<REF(L,2) AND REF(L,2)>REF(L,3);
  41. 包顶2:=H<REF(H,2) AND REF(H,2)>REF(H,3) AND L<REF(L,1) AND REF(L,1)>REF(L,3);
  42. 复底:=IF(包含1,包底1,IF(包含2,包底2,简底));
  43. 复顶:=IF(包含1,包顶1,IF(包含2,包顶2,简顶));
  44. 底分型:=IF(BARSLAST(CROSS(牛熊线,重心线))>3,FILTER(BACKSET(FILTER(复底 AND 重心线<牛熊线,3),2),1),0);
  45. 顶分型:=IF(BARSLAST(CROSS(重心线,牛熊线))>3,FILTER(BACKSET(FILTER(复顶 AND 重心线>牛熊线,3),2),1),0);
复制代码

沧海一粟 | 2025-4-28 23:56:55 | 显示全部楼层
34我6346346
nwhqeqgz | 2025-4-17 22:59:38 | 显示全部楼层
实现踩踩踩踩踩
PantaRhei | 2025-3-28 11:15:27 | 显示全部楼层
学习
PantaRhei | 2025-3-28 11:07:50 | 显示全部楼层
好用
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则